18c2ecf20Sopenharmony_cimsm8916 digital audio CODEC 28c2ecf20Sopenharmony_ci 38c2ecf20Sopenharmony_ci## Bindings for codec core in lpass: 48c2ecf20Sopenharmony_ci 58c2ecf20Sopenharmony_ciRequired properties 68c2ecf20Sopenharmony_ci - compatible = "qcom,msm8916-wcd-digital-codec"; 78c2ecf20Sopenharmony_ci - reg: address space for lpass codec. 88c2ecf20Sopenharmony_ci - clocks: Handle to mclk and ahbclk 98c2ecf20Sopenharmony_ci - clock-names: should be "mclk", "ahbix-clk". 108c2ecf20Sopenharmony_ci 118c2ecf20Sopenharmony_ciExample: 128c2ecf20Sopenharmony_ci 138c2ecf20Sopenharmony_ciaudio-codec@771c000{ 148c2ecf20Sopenharmony_ci compatible = "qcom,msm8916-wcd-digital-codec"; 158c2ecf20Sopenharmony_ci reg = <0x0771c000 0x400>; 168c2ecf20Sopenharmony_ci clocks = <&gcc GCC_ULTAUDIO_AHBFABRIC_IXFABRIC_CLK>, 178c2ecf20Sopenharmony_ci <&gcc GCC_CODEC_DIGCODEC_CLK>; 188c2ecf20Sopenharmony_ci clock-names = "ahbix-clk", "mclk"; 198c2ecf20Sopenharmony_ci #sound-dai-cells = <1>; 208c2ecf20Sopenharmony_ci}; 21